Cookies are small text files placed on to your computer by the websites you visit. They help the website work properly, improve your experience and allow website-owners to
analyse visits. When you first visit a site that uses cookies, a simple text file is downloaded on to your computer, which is then read each time you return to that site. The
file, called a ‘cookie’, can be used to remember your preferences, or to personalise searches that you have conducted in the past.
